Weight-Loss Surgery for a Better Health When will be the day the war against obesity is finally over? In the last decade, people becoming obese and overweight has become a global issue. Obesity significantly increases the risks of developing a large variety of health-related problems. Diet, exercise and weight-loss surgeries are the most common solutions to this problem. Many people get tired of trying to change their diets; they lack the motivation to become more active or to get so many medications to lose weight. For whatever reason they may have, they stay on the path to becoming overweight. With modern science and newer technologies emerging everyday, weight-loss surgeries have become one of the most popular and useful tools to fight obesity. As a treatment for severe obesity, weight-loss surgery is an excellent option to lose weight because it can eliminate or alleviate many obesity-related medical conditions, as well as help patients remove a large percentage of body fat and improve the quality of life in the patients. Weight-loss surgery is a great tool to improve or take away many obesity-related medical conditions such as diabetes and high blood pressure. Two of the most popular weight-loss surgeries are The Roux-en-Y Gastric Bypass and The Lap-Band. These surgical procedures are excellent options for individuals with severe obesity problems. Not everyone is a good candidate for this type of surgeries. Weight loss surgery may be considered only after trying many other treatments that have not worked successfully. When these type of medical procedures are performed properly, it can save the patient’s life. For most patients, these surgeries help to highly improve their health in general.
